Web Spelling Login, spelled as one word, is only a noun or an adjective. For example, the information you use to sign in to your email is your login (noun), and the page where you sign in is the login page (adjective). Log in is two words when it functions as a verb. For example, you log in with your login information. WebMay 31, 2016 · standalone / stand-alone. Despite the fact that it’s been slow to appear in traditional dictionaries, the adjective “standalone”—meaning “independent”—has become hugely popular in recent years. There are standalone electronic devices, standalone computer applications, and standalone businesses.
